So....as a fellow south paw, why not a LH 870, a Browning BPS or Ithaca M37.Prefer a Mossy 590a1, but current gun is an ex-CHP 870.
As a lefty, Mossberg safety is easier to manipulate, gun is lighter and it's hard to beat 8+1 roinds in the 20" A1.
That said, the 870 is the "AR or 10/22" of the shotgun world, hard to beat for sheer volume of aftermarket support.
